Cisco SFP 10g Bidi Compatible 10gbase Bidi 1330nm-Tx/1270nm-Rx 10km Industrial Dom SFP Module 10g Bidi
MVSLINK Cisco-compatible SFP+ transceiver supports up to 10km link lengths over OS2 SMF via an LC simplex connector. This 10G BiDi SFP+ transceiver features data transmission over a single strand of fiber; the one transceiver transmits a 1270-nm channel and receives a 1330-nm signal, whereas the other BiDi SFP+ optic transmits at a 1330-nm wavelength and receives a 1270-nm signal.
Each BIDI SFP+ transceiver module is individually tested to be used on a series of switches, routers, servers, network interface cards (NICs) etc. Featuring low power consumption and high speed, this 10G BIDI SFP+ transceiver is ideal for enterprise wiring closets, service provider transport applications, Radio & Baseband Units, etc.

FAQ
Q: What is the main difference between the BIDI module and the conventional optical module?
A: The primary difference from traditional duplex optical modules is that the BiDi optical module operates as a simplex module, allowing the customer to double the utilization of the existing fiber. Besides, a bidirectional transceiver doubles the amount of network equipment that can be attached to the same set of 4 fibers, compared to regular transceivers.
Q: Whether this transceiver is having both transmitter and receiver at one single point?
A: Yes, this module is a single fiber bidirectional module that utilizes wavelength division multiplexing (WDM) technology for bidirectional transmission.
Q: Since it is simplex, does it transmit at the wavelength of 1270 nm from End A to End B and receive at the wavelength of 1330 nm from End B to End A at two different times?
A: Filtering is accomplished through the filters in the optical module while simultaneously transmitting the TX optical signal and receiving the RX optical signal, or vice versa.
